Kagiso Trust is excited to announce its Internship Programs for 2024. Based in Johannesburg, South Africa, this program is designed for motivated individuals seeking to make an impact in the nonprofit sector. Interns will have the opportunity to work on various projects related to community development, education, and social change.

Position Purpose

The Kagiso Trust Internship Program aims to provide practical experience and professional development opportunities in the nonprofit sector. Interns will support various projects and initiatives, gaining valuable insights into program management, community outreach, and organizational operations.

Duties And Responsibilities

  • Assist with the planning and execution of community development projects and initiatives.
  • Support the development and implementation of educational programs and outreach activities.
  • Conduct research and provide analysis on project effectiveness and community needs.
  • Help prepare reports, presentations, and other documentation for internal and external stakeholders.
  • Participate in team meetings and contribute to discussions on strategic planning and project development.
  • Manage administrative tasks such as data entry, document organization, and scheduling.

Education

  • Currently pursuing or recently completed a degree in Social Sciences, Community Development, Education, Public Administration, or a related field.

Experience

  • No prior professional experience is required; however, relevant coursework, volunteer work, or internships in nonprofit or community-focused roles is advantageous.

Skills

  • Strong organizational and problem-solving skills.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ite (Excel, Word, PowerPoint) and familiarity with data management tools.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ication abilities.
  • Ability to work effectively both independently and as part of a team.
  • Passion for community development and social change.

Beneficiaries Of The Internship Programme

  • Gain hands-on experience in nonprofit project management and community development.
  • Develop skills in research, analysis, and program implementation.
  • Build a professional network within the nonprofit sector.
  • Receive mentorship and career guidance from experienced professionals at Kagiso Trust.
